“Every year after Christmas Eve I’m left with a huge pile of extra gifts. So I decided to build an epic Winter Wonderland Outlet where I can make the gifts available for everyone. I’ve found a building for that but it needs some serious renovating. That’s where you come in. This is the Unbelievable Challenge 2017.”
- Mr. Santa Claus

The big idea: What is your unique, inspiring and innovative solution for Mr. Santa Claus’ epic Winter Wonderland Outlet?
Mr. Santa Claus’ main idea is to create an inspiring and exciting shopping mall front that provides a setting for unique experiences and attracts big customer flows. That is to say, the design should invite people to visit and spend time inside the mall.
Ruukki building materials are to be utilised as a part of the overall design.

Prize
The submitter of the winning proposal is awarded a fully paid 10-week internship for one person at Snøhetta, the international architecture, landscape architecture, interior design and brand design company in Oslo, Norway. The internship takes place in Autumn 2018 (the precise time is to be negotiated later on). The intern will be given the opportunity to work on interesting projects corresponding to their area of expertise and interest. The approximate total value of the internship is €25,000 (including salary, taxes, deductions and rent for an apartment in Oslo). The details of the internship will be agreed more specically between the winner and Snøhetta.
In the case where the winning proposal is made by a team of more than one person that team will choose the intern. The chosen candidate for the internship shall give the presentation to the jury on December 14th.
Additionally, the jury will award the winning proposal and a minimum of four (4) other proposals with a cash prize of €1,000 each, and may also give honourable mentions.
